History and Origins
Kumara is believed to have originated in Central and South America, with archaeological evidence suggesting its cultivation dates back over 5,000 years. It spread to various regions, including the Pacific Islands and eventually to Asia and Africa, where it adapted to local growing conditions. In New Zealand, kumara holds significant cultural importance, especially among the Māori people, who regard it as a staple food. The name “kumara” itself comes from the Māori language.
The spread of kumara across different cultures has led to the development of numerous varieties, each with distinct flavors, colors, and textures. This rich history not only highlights the ingredient’s versatility but also its importance in global food security.
Production and Processing
Kumara is primarily grown in warm climates, thriving in well-drained, sandy soils rich in organic matter. The growing season typically lasts between 90 to 120 days, depending on the variety and environmental conditions.
Cultivation Methods
1. Soil Preparation: Preparing the soil involves tilling and adding organic matter to enhance fertility and drainage. The ideal pH for kumara is between 5.8 and 6.5.
2. Planting: Kumara is propagated from slips, which are shoots that grow from mature tubers. These slips are planted in rows with sufficient spacing to allow for growth.
3. Watering: Though kumara is drought-tolerant, consistent watering is crucial during the initial growth phase. Once established, the plant requires less frequent irrigation.
4. Weed and Pest Management: Regular monitoring for pests and weeds is essential. Organic methods, such as mulching and hand weeding, are often employed to manage pests without harmful chemicals.
5. Harvesting: Kumara is usually ready for harvest when the foliage begins to yellow and die back. Careful harvesting is necessary to avoid damaging the tubers, which can lead to spoilage.
Processing
Post-harvest, kumara undergoes curing, a process that enhances its flavor and extends shelf life. This involves storing the harvested tubers in a warm, humid environment for several days. After curing, they are sorted and graded based on size and quality before being packaged for distribution.
Quality and Grading
The quality of kumara is determined by several factors, including size, shape, color, and absence of defects. Grading is essential for both marketability and consumer satisfaction.
- Size: Larger tubers are often preferred in retail settings.
- Shape: Uniformity in shape indicates quality cultivation practices.
- Color: Kumara can range from orange to purple, with vibrant colors typically associated with higher nutrient content.
- Defects: Any blemishes, cuts, or signs of rot can affect grading and should be avoided.

Buying Considerations
When purchasing kumara, several factors should be considered to ensure quality and freshness:
1. Variety: Different varieties offer unique flavors and textures. Familiarizing oneself with local options can enhance culinary experiences.
2. Freshness: Look for firm, unblemished tubers. Avoid those with soft spots or signs of sprouting.
3. Seasonality: Kumara is typically harvested in late summer to early fall. Buying in season ensures better flavor and freshness.
4. Source: Local farmers’ markets or organic suppliers often provide fresher options compared to large grocery chains.

Common Misconceptions
Despite its popularity, several misconceptions about kumara persist:
1. Sweet Potatoes vs. Yams: Many confuse kumara with yams, which are distinct species with different flavors and textures. Yams are typically starchier and drier.
